The reference:
Patterson, B.K., Till, M., Otto, P., Goolsby, C., Furtado M.R., McBride, L.J.,
Wolinsky, S.M., Detection of HIV-1 DNA and Messenger RNA in Individual Cells by
PCR-Driven in Situ Hybridization and Flow Cytometry, Science, Vol. 260, 14 May,
1993, pp. 976-979

> We have been wondering if anybody has used flow cytometry to count the
> number of infected cells in HIV-1 patients. Any communications of
> correlation to molecular biology (ie. semiquantitative HIV-1 RNA-PCR)?
>
> If so, is the infected fraction predictive of clinical outcome of HIV-1
> infected patients?
